MCC Rx Services Job Summary:
Provides expert leadership in assisting the Pharmacy Manager/Supervisor or designee to train and coordinate the efforts of a group of pharmacy technicians into an efficient support team. Assigns and coordinates the work schedule for a large group of technicians. Monitors technician activities to support compliance to hospital and department policies and procedures. Participates in interviews with pharmacy technician candidates and selection. Participates in coordination of orientation and training of new pharmacy technicians as well as the ongoing training for new processes or procedures. Participates in the performance assessment of staff in assigned areas. Under the direction of pharmacy management, coordinates data collection and analysis of quality, efficiency, and service data for a designated pharmacy area or areas and takes corrective action, if applicable. . Monroe Carell Jr. Children's Hospital at Vanderbilt is seeking a Pharmacy Technician Coordinator to join our Clinic Pharmacy team! Position Highlights Clinic hours are 6:30am
- 5:00pm weekdays and 7:00am
- 3:30pm weekends.
This pharmacy provides TPN's to admitted pediatric patients and medication infusions to clinic outpatients. Staffing responsibilities include but are not limited to; compounding sterile medications including TPN's, stocking, delivering, and assisting the pharmacist as needed. Coordinator responsibilities include management of technician team, training, inventory control/ordering, developing/maintaining new processes, cleanroom compliance, and working collaboratively with pharmacy management. Must be a Certified Pharmacy Technician through either PTCB or NHA in order to be considered. Four years of relevant experience required. We're the largest private employer in Middle Tennessee, with a growing team and expanding footprint in towns and communities across the region. We employ more than 28,000 people who work in inpatient and outpatient clinical care, research, and graduate medical education as well as critical supporting roles in administration, information technology and informatics, finance, legal and community affairs, communications and marketing, fund-raising, groundskeeping and facilities, and many more. Our growing health system has more than 1,700 licensed hospital beds at: Vanderbilt University Hospital Monroe Carell Jr. Children's Hospital at Vanderbilt Vanderbilt Psychiatric Hospital Vanderbilt Stallworth Rehabilitation Hospital Vanderbilt Wilson County Hospital Vanderbilt Bedford Hospital Vanderbilt Tullahoma-Harton Hospital It's also home to hundreds of outpatient clinic and surgical locations throughout the region. We serve our community with many unique and specialized services including the Level 1 Trauma Center, a highly experienced Transplant Center that does the most heart transplants in the world, a National Cancer Institute-designated Comprehensive Cancer Center, Lung Institute, Burn Center and many more.
